The goal of carbohydrate loading is to increase your athletic performance by providing you with the energy you need to finish an endurance exercise with less exhaustion.
Because more carbohydrates are stored as glycogen in the muscles and liver, a diet heavy in carbohydrates improves both stamina and intermittent excellent performance.Carbohydrates have 4 calories per gram.
Increased muscular glycogen stores, which are known to extend exercise and enhance long-term performance, are a result of glucose loading.
